Two generations grew up on the farm.
Then on Oct 21, 1908 in Brown County, Albert married Jennie L Thomas
Albert & Jennie, along with son, Delbert, lived with Albert's parents until the 1930's.
Delbert remembered when he was but 16, helping his father carry his grandmother's body to the family cemetery when she died in 1930.
In later years, Albert and Jennie moved to Mt. Sterling
After Jennie died, Albert never remarried but remained in Mt. Sterling until 1969 when he moved to Hickory Hills, Illinois to live with his son Delbert
Albert died just short of his 100th birthday
Both of his sisters also lived long lives:
Lena (91)& Amelia (85)
